Transaction abfcda726cf2b0a67ee7c93c1e7334140385439612205912439fda0ed156667e
1 Input
1 Output
-
abfcda726cf2b0a67ee7c93c1e7334140385439612205912439fda0ed156667e:0
- value
- 8288622
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dfa30eb1a338466401dc93a0e8f32a1cd54ef14 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DwhzdWxVuDYnV2NL5TssW7o5hPWZBd88w